Advanced Detection Methods and Tools

Beyond what the naked eye can see, skilled technicians often utilize specialized tools and techniques to ensure accurate detection of roof leaks near Silver Lake:

  • Moisture Meters: These devices are used to detect hidden moisture within your attic or wall cavities, indicating where water has penetrated beyond the visible surface.
  • Infrared Cameras (Thermal Imaging): These cameras can identify temperature differences on surfaces, which often reveal areas where moisture is present, even if it’s not yet visible. This is particularly effective for finding leaks that travel before appearing indoors.
  • Water Testing: In some cases, technicians will simulate rainfall by carefully running water over specific sections of the roof while observers on the inside watch for signs of intrusion. This method is highly effective for isolating leaks in complex roofing systems.
  • Drone Technology: For difficult-to-access or steep roofs, drones equipped with high-resolution cameras can provide detailed aerial views, identifying potential problem areas without the need for direct roof access in every instance.

The choice of method often depends on the complexity of the roof, the apparent severity of the leak, and the experience of the roofing contractor. Local professionals serving Silver Lake understand the particular challenges posed by the region’s residential architecture and climate.

Common Roofing Issues Leading to Leaks in Silver Lake

Silver Lake, like many Southern California communities, experiences a range of weather conditions that can stress roofing systems. Understanding these common culprits can help homeowners be more vigilant:

  • Aging or Damaged Shingles: Over time, asphalt shingles can become brittle, crack, or blow off, especially during high winds common during Santa Ana events.
  • Flashing Failures: The metal flashing around chimneys, vents, skylights, and valleys is critical. Corrosion, damage from debris, or improper installation can create direct pathways for water.
  • Gutter and Drainage Issues: Clogged gutters, common after dust storms or in areas with abundant trees, can cause water to pool on the roof deck or seep into eaves and fascia.
  • Cracked Vent Boots: The rubber boots around plumbing vents can deteriorate due to sun exposure, leading to leaks.
  • Loose or Damaged Tiles: Many homes in Silver Lake feature tile roofs, which can be susceptible to cracking or displacement from walking on them improperly or from impact by falling branches.

Can a roof leak cause damage that isn’t immediately visible, and how do leak detection services find those hidden issues?

Yes, roof leaks can cause significant damage that isn’t immediately visible. Water can travel through your roof deck, insulation, and rafters before appearing as a stain on your ceiling. It can also seep into wall cavities. Professional roof leak detection services utilize specialized tools like moisture meters and infrared cameras. These tools help identify areas of hidden moisture or temperature discrepancies that indicate water intrusion, even behind drywall or under layers of roofing material, ensuring a comprehensive assessment of the leak’s true extent.
